    1. Physical reasons:

    The most common cause of physical causes is noise. If a person lives or works in a very noisy environment for a long time, such as tractor and car drivers, traffic police, armed police, soldiers, discotheque workers, mahjong game players, long-term reporting workers, and operators of various equipment, etc., long-term noise stimulation will most likely cause ear canal nerve damage, and they usually become tinnitus patients. In addition, if there is a serious head trauma in an accident, it is also possible to damage the nerves in the ear canal, causing tinnitus or even more serious ear diseases.

    3. Causes of disease:

    Some diseases of the ears and other parts of the human body are also likely to cause tinnitus if not treated immediately. For example, when foreign bodies in the external auditory canal (earwax) touch the eardrum, vascular malformations and diseases in the ear ; Vascular malformation or hemorrheology causes irregular blood supply to the brain and inner ear, or vascular noise caused by abnormal blood vessels in the neck and cranial cavity is transmitted to the ear. ; In addition, Meniere's disease, acoustic neuroma, sclerosis, etc. are also potential factors causing tinnitus.
